Press Release: Congressman Eric Sorensen Votes Against $70 Billion Funding for ICE and CBP

None

Congressman Eric Sorensen opposes $70 billion funding for ICE and CBP, advocating for investments in healthcare and essential services.

Quiver AI Summary

Congressman Sorensen's Funding Opposition: Congressman Eric Sorensen (IL-17) publicly stated his opposition to an additional $70 billion funding for ICE and CBP during a recent vote, expressing concern that such funds would be misused for political purposes rather than community needs.

Constituent Interests Highlighted: Sorensen stressed, “My constituents want tax dollars spent on lowering healthcare costs, not funding agencies that tear families apart,” underscoring his commitment to representing the interests of those in Central and Northwestern Illinois.

Background Information: Eric Sorensen, formerly a local meteorologist, has served in Congress since representing Illinois' 17th District, which encompasses areas including the Quad Cities, Rockford, Peoria, and Bloomington-Normal.

Eric Sorensen Fundraising

Eric Sorensen Fundraising

Eric Sorensen recently disclosed $270.6K of fundraising in a Q1 FEC disclosure filed on April 15th, 2026. This was the 431st most from all Q1 reports we have seen this year. 46.6% came from individual donors.

Sorensen disclosed $61.2K of spending. This was the 1026th most from all Q1 reports we have seen from politicians so far this year.

Sorensen disclosed $1.2M of cash on hand at the end of the filing period. This was the 370th most from all Q1 reports we have seen this year.
